“If you really have to be in Clifton, this is the one, as the location's great and although information at time of booking is sketchy, there is a limited (but covered!) parking facility.
I do regard the lack of cental heating on a particularly cold morning unacceptable (especially when it had been running just fine when I'd arrived the previous afternoon) and I agree with others' comments on this site with regard to the poky rooms and poor showers / shower curtains.
Yes, the area is noisy (or is that vibrant?!) but that's Clifton for you; it's not the hotel's fault.”

“Overall the hotel was in a good location however the room was shabbier and smaller than we would have expected for the price that we paid. They did have fruit in the room which was a nice touch though. The bathroom was tiny and old and could have done with a refurb (as could the whole room). The hotel was very hot in the rooms but we didn't have a fan in our room (other rooms did) which would have made it a bit more comfortable. The bar downstairs was pretty good and had an outdoor seating area which was nice. Overall if it had a bit of a refurb it would offer more value for money - as it is at the moment it wasn't worth what we paid and we were a bit disappointed.”
